     * This script is to check if there is any merge commit that brings changes from release branch to master.
     *
     * Usage (Java 11+ single-file source execution):
     *   java .teamcity/scripts/CheckBadMerge.java < commits.txt
     *
     * If any "bad" merge commit is found, it will print the details and exit with non-zero code.
